Thank you for purchasing the OKAI electric bike.
1.Introduction
OKAI sincerely hopes that you can ride the bike safely and enjoy a comfortable riding experience.
Since riding a bike carries certain risks, please read this practical manual carefully before riding, and
adequately prepare before going on the road. Please keep the instruction manual in case you need it
from time to time. If you give the electric bike to others, please also provide them with this user
manual. Failure to comply with this user manual may cause serious injury to people or cause damage
to the product. OKAI does not assume any responsibility for this. In order to be concise and easy to
read, the OKAI E-Bike will be referred to as “product” in the following Content.

*Specifications are subject to change without prior notice.
*Range: When fully charged, with a load of 75kg, an ambient temperature of 25°C, driving on a flat
road with human-assisted.
*Factors affecting the range include: speed, ambient temperature, climbing, number of starts and
stops, etc.

3-1.Safety instructions
This section lists the safety instructions that should be followed when using this product.
·An electric bike is intended for sport and entertainment purposes, not for use as a means of
transportation, but the transportation faction of the product once you drive it into public areas (as
permitted by the laws and regulations of your region and country)also carries potential safety risks for
all vehicles. Drive strictly in accordance with the instructions in this manual to ensure the safety of
yourself and others to the utmost extent, and to ensure compliance with national first-level traffic
laws and regulations of various provinces and cities, such as traffic regulations, etc.
·Please note: Once you drive an electric bike on public roads or other public places (as permitted by
the laws and regulations of your region and country regarding the use of electric bike on public roads
or other public places), even if you fully comply with this safe driving guide operation, you may also
face risks caused by illegal driving/improper operation by others, or other vehicles. Just like when
walking or riding a bicycle, you may also be injured by other vehicles. As with any vehicle, the faster
you drive an electric bike, the longer the distance required to brake, and emergency braking on
smooth surfaces may also cause the wheels to slip and lose balance or even fall over. Therefore, it is
very important to be vigilant when driving, maintain a proper speed, and maintain a reasonable and
safe distance from other people and vehicles. When driving on unfamiliar terrain, stay alert and drive
at a low speed.
·Please respect the pedestrian's right of way when driving. Avoid frightening pedestrians, especially
children.
·When driving in countries and regions where there are currently no national standards and
regulations related to electric bike, such as China, please be sure to comply with the safety require-
ments for drivers in this manual. Zhejiang Okai Vehicle Co., Ltd will not bear any direct or joint
liabilities for any financial losses, losses of life, legal disputes, or any other unfavorable events that
occur due to the violation of the recommended uses indicated in this manual.
·To avoid potential injury, do not lend the electric biker to people who can't operate it. If you give the
electric bike to a friend to use, please be responsible for your friend's safety, teach them to operate
the bike, and tell them to wear protective equipment.
·Please perform a basic inspection of the electric bike before each driving. If you find that there are
loose parts, the battery life is obviously reduced, the tires are excessively worn, the steering makes
abnormal noises or malfunctions, etc., please stop using the bike immediately, and do not force it to
drive.
It may be dangerous to use this product! Learn to use the product step by step and spend enough
time in practicing. Please follow all the tips and warnings set forth in this manual to reduce risk of
injury. Even if you have enough practice, guidance or expertise, you may still lose control, collide or
fall over, which may cause serious harm to yourself or others.
1. Keep the printed instructions for further reference and read carefully before use.
2. Maximum speed allowed: 32 km/h (20mph)
3. Pregnant women, the disabled, and those who suffer from heart, head, back or neck conditions (or
have undergone operations on these parts) should not use this product.

08
4. Do not use this product after taking alcohol, sedatives or psychoactive drugs.
5. Keep a distance of at least 1m/3ft from pedestrians, other vehicles and any obstacles.
6. This product can only be used when the environment permits it and the personal safety of
bystanders is guaranteed.
7. Pay attention to the obstacles in front and of those far away.
8. This product may be used by only one person. It is forbidden to use this product with others. Don't
make sharp turns when driving the bike at high speeds.
9. Avoid sudden acceleration or sudden braking; do not lean your body for acceleration.
10. Excessive forward or backward is strictly prohibited.
11. Do not misuse this product. Do not use this product on roadsides, ramps, in skate parks, empty
swimming pools, or any place similar to sliding plates.
12. Do not use this product to cross obstacles, slopes, ice or snow, nor climb up or down steep slopes,
stairs or escalators. Do not expose this product in the rain.
13. Do not use this product in places where the depth of the puddle exceeds 10cm / 3.94in, because
water may enter the motor.
14. Don't jump on this product. Don't try to use this product to do any acrobatics or activities not
intended.
15. In order to avoid distraction when riding, please do not wear earphones, earplugs, make or
answer calls, take pictures or videos or do any activities that are not related to riding so that you may
maintain an awareness of your surroundings at all times.
16. Be sure to hold both handles when riding.
17. Avoid using this product at night or in places with poor visibility.
18. When you encounter pedestrians or other obstacles, check if you can pass safely.
19. Please use this product and its accessories at an appropriate temperature. Pay attention to the
temperature requirements for battery charging.
20. Please always wear personal protective equipment (to protect wrists, knees, head and elbows)
suitable for your weight and size to avoid injury. In working areas, local laws or regulations may have
minimum requirements for helmets. In addition, it is suggested that safety mirrors be worn.
21. According to French traffic rules, reflective clothing and helmet is strongly required when riding.
22. Do not hang this product with other products or vehicles.
23. When not used, this product should be parked with the kickstand.
24. Any load added to the handle will affect the stability of the bike.
25. WARNING! The braking distance will be extended under humid conditions.
26. WARNING! If any mechanical parts are subject to great external pressure and wear, different
materials and parts may react differently. If a part exceeds the expected service life, it may suddenly
break, which may cause injury. Cracks, scratches and discoloration in the area affected by external
pressure indicate that the part has exceeded its service life and should be replaced as soon as
possible.
27. Please spend enough time practicing how to use this product, so as to avoid accidents caused by
lack of skills.
28. If training is required, the seller may provide corresponding training tutorials
29. When you are approaching pedestrians or cyclists, you may ring the bell to alert them.
30. When passing a protected passage, please dismount from the bike and walk through it.
31. Pay attention to protect your own safety and the safety of others in all cases.
32. Do not use this product for other purposes such as carrying people and objects.
33. Using the brake for long durations may cause it to heat up. Avoid touching them to prevent burns.
34. Regularly check all bolts and screws, especially the axles, folding system, steering system and
brake shaft.
